Dome Volcanoes . Learn about lava domes, common volcanic features formed by viscous magma piling up around the vent. Landforms of this sort consist of steep domal mounds of lava so viscous that the lava piles up over its vent without flowing away. Slowly rising lava domes may grow for months or for several years in the aftermath of explosive eruptions. Explore the four main types of lava domes (torta, peléean, coulées and upheaved.
